Pawn Делаем плавный шлагбаум

  • Автор темы Amfy
  • Дата начала
  • Отмеченные пользователи Нет
0)//Если status_slak где 613.90, сработала шлагбаума. ставим MoveObject(obj_slak, шлагбаума } == true) шлагбаум ОТКРЫТ, закрытого { 7.0, ID координаты открываем 0.00, чтобы 0.004, 0.00, 613.90, MoveObject(obj_slak, 1; == Вот { должен "статус" = координаты 0;//Ставим -90.00, это находится 13.42)) фракции игрок status_slak = код 0) ЗАКРЫТ return закрываем { ОТКРЫТ 1; if(!IsPlayerConnected(playerid))
C++:
 радиус открытого 13.42-0.004, его 0.00, -105.00);//Здесь 1)//Если "/licopen", 10. шлагбаум 1680.97, - 1;//Ставим ЗАКРЫТ, } } return if(status_slak if(status_slak 613.90, 13.42+0.004, -105.00);//Здесь 1680.97, [B][/B], if(strcmp(cmd, шлагбаума 0.004, его
ставим команда else 1680.97, return if(!IsPlayerInRangeOfPoint(playerid, "статус" == шлагбаума. шлагбаума. 1;//7.0
 
= должен шлагбаум if(PlayerInfo[playerid][pMember] открываем = 613.90, == -105.00);//Здесь "статус" ставим 13.42-0.004, закрываем это 1680.97, его к == ОТКРЫТ сработала { == MoveObject(obj_slak, else так: { сообщению:[/I] 1680.97, радиус координаты status_slak команда чтобы return = ставим status_slak return -105.00);//Здесь 13.42)) == ЗАКРЫТ, 613.90, шлагбаума [/CODE] { шлагбаума. status_slak закрытого его 1)//Если PlayerInfo[playerid][pLeader] шлагбаума 1; открытого шлагбаум 0)//Если 0.004, или 13.42-0.004, где это Дополнение ЗАКРЫТ } ЗАКРЫТ 0.00, радиус 1;//Ставим send(playerid,"У status_slak открываем -105.00);//Здесь "статус" if(strcmp(cmd, } MoveObject(obj_slak, допуска!"); ОТКРЫТ, true) 13.42+0.004, ОТКРЫТ, MoveObject(obj_slak, шлагбаума. его 1; 1; if(GetPlayerFrac(playerid) if(!IsPlayerConnected(playerid)) шлагбаума 0.004, находится Вас 613.90, } 613.90, 0.00, 0.004, 7.0, { } координаты 0;//Ставим команда 13.42+0.004, 1)//Если return "статус" игрок if(!IsPlayerInRangeOfPoint(playerid, открытого шлагбаума ОТКРЫТ "статус" == else if(!IsPlayerInRangeOfPoint(playerid, 0;//Ставим if(status_slak MoveObject(obj_slak, 613.90, 7.0, шлагбаум if(status_slak != 0.00, 613.90, } ставим 1680.97, игрок 10) return
C++:
 нет координаты 1;//Ставим шлагбаума. 1680.97, закрытого 1680.97, ЗАКРЫТ, закрываем -90.00, = if(status_slak || 0.004, чтобы 0.00, сработала } 0) 0.00, шлагбаум - 10) { ставим == 0.00, 1680.97, == -105.00);//Здесь if(!IsPlayerConnected(playerid)) координаты 1;//7.0 0)//Если должен 10 "/licopen", return 13.42)) 1; return где шлагбаума. его - return 1;//7.0 -90.00, if(status_slak находится
 
тоже сделать, доступа? коде , нету как А вас типо во писало чтобы 2 у
 
10) if(PlayerInfo[playerid][pMember] return нет send(playerid,"У
C++:
 != Вас допуска!");
 
шлагбаума открываем return 4.0000,91.0000,199.5800);//Здесь шлагбаум 1; MoveObject(obj_slak2, 0.004, } status_slak полностью == if(status_slak2 0;//Ставим шлагбаума. if(!IsPlayerConnected(playerid)) ОТКРЫТ, if(strcmp(cmd, if(!IsPlayerConnected(playerid)) == 0)//Если 0.004, 1; 2041.7634, секунды ОТКРЫТ { "/slak", -834.7704, радиус "статус" игрок 4.0000, 0) ставим 15.5315+0.004, ставим ЗАКРЫТ else открыт/закрыт.[/B][/COLOR] -828.7983, 9.0, , шлагбаума второй -828.8087, = MoveObject(obj_slak2, 15.5465+0.004, 0;//Ставим команда 3.0000, 15.5465-0.004, шлагбаум есть шлагбаум уже игрок кмд ЗАКРЫТ, это шлагбаума во { сработала его где 1; = координаты команда а координаты "статус" if(!IsPlayerInRangeOfPoint(playerid, 9.0, == status_slak2 2024.8849, ставим } 1)//Если "статус" { else 1;//7.0 закрытого находится - 15.5465)) } В 0.004, if(strcmp(cmd, радиус ставим чтобы координаты = то шлагбаум шлагбаума. 0.004, if(status_slak чтобы 1)//Если отлично MoveObject(obj_slak, его его 19.0000);//Здесь открывается, 2041.7369, ОТКРЫТ он { 0)//Если 1;//Ставим должен 2024.8849, шлагбаума -828.8087, шлагбаум -834.7704, медленно, 1; true) if(status_slak2 true) return == 1;//Ставим 19.0000);//Здесь return где за должен 15.5315)) закрываем { первой шлагбаума. (/slak) ОТКРЫТ, if(!IsPlayerInRangeOfPoint(playerid, return 3.0000, } кмд 15.5915-0.004, открытого 1-2 шлагбаума. закрываем { его 1;//7.0 открытого == = return == ЗАКРЫТ, if(status_slak } сработала status_slak status_slak2 MoveObject(obj_slak, координаты закрытого 2041.7634, открываем 91.0000, это return P.S. находится 0) ЗАКРЫТ } "статус" 2024.8849, -834.7704, (/slak2) 4.0000,11.0000,200.0000);//Здесь - "/slak2",
 
как всё сервере. надо вроде Не Basis, на проверять знаю, нормально,
 
поставил работает + спасибо норм все
 
помогите but assumed error : шлагбаума. 001: invalid Ошибка закрытого [/CODE] found MoveObject(slak_derev2, 0.00,90.00,0.00));//Здесь 029: ставим 2383.49,-906.23,1.84, C:\Users\Клим\Desktop\MRP\gamemodes\mrp.pwn(24406) zero error [/CODE]
C++:
 expression, : token: expected координаты ")" ";", C:\Users\Клим\Desktop\MRP\gamemodes\mrp.pwn(24406) [CODE]
 
попробовал один со проблема Поставил вторым командой второй же — второй, шлагбаумом... шлагбаум отдельности? ли просто /slak? случилась командой То автору!!! той полосы одной сделать управлять не и плюс для у мосту зоне первого Но каждый я а открывать Огромнейший по ими второго своей — меня есть находясь но движения. в Могу реагирует((( их шлагбаум, на зоне в поинта
 
шлагбаумов на коды бы киньте так перекрывали Поставьте и шлагбаум координаты друга. действия что каждый отдельные не они радиус каждого. друг корды Или для Emwonku, и уменьшите
 
координаты
C++:
 убери 0.00,90.00,0.00);//Здесь вторую 2383.49,-906.23,1.84, MoveObject(slak_derev2, закрытого [B][USER=5101]@Andew[/USER][/B], скобку. ставим шлагбаума.
 
Уже ли? так может ставим не координаты [/QUOTE]Он задана. шлагбаума. Дополнение 2383.49,-906.23,1.84, скопировать закрытого 30957"]24406 MoveObject(slak_derev2, [QUOTE="danilasar, плавным, внимательно. не будет пусть сообщению: не читает скорость к что Тему 0.00,90.00,0.00);//Здесь post:
 
RuHack,Спасибо, сам удалить допёр но но как уже незнал.
 
1; = сработала ставим где находится true) это 1;//7.0 шлагбаум чтобы new new']new } //------------------------------------------------------------------------------ ОТКРЫТ } == - "статус" { } ОТКРЫТ -1676.43958,556.5943,37.3641)) 0;//Ставим { status_slak; return = //ШЛАГБАУМ MoveObject(obj_slak, return 0)//Если сработала радиус
C++:
 if(!IsPlayerConnected(playerid)) его 1; шлагбаума { "статус" где -1668.7000,553.5862,37.8530+0.004, == else return 1;//Ставим 1; открытого == закрытого ставим его 0) "/slak", 0.02, 15.0, if(status_slak чтобы { 0.00000,90.00000,135.1000);//Здесь status_slak -1668.6481,553.5288,37.9824-0.004, 0.02, это должен //ШЛАГБАУМ
координаты return радиус 1;//Ставим if(strcmp(cmd, == команда 0.000000,0.000000,136.9800);//Здесь return находится
C++:
 15.0, status_slak 0.000000,-90.000000,136.9800);//Здесь status_slak1 открываем == закрытого шлагбаума [B][/B], ЗАКРЫТ status_slak 0) координаты координаты шлагбаума. ЗАКРЫТ ставим шлагбаума шлагбаума. шлагбаум игрок = 0;//Ставим MoveObject(obj_slak, открытого ОТКРЫТ, закрываем == if(status_slak if(strcmp(cmd, -1658.1230,543.4621,37.9025+0.004, игрок шлагбаум 0.02, return 1)//Если шлагбаума. if(!IsPlayerConnected(playerid)) должен MoveObject(obj_slak, шлагбаум ОТКРЫТ, } = if(!IsPlayerInRangeOfPoint(playerid, его { команда -1658.2186,543.5646,37.9824-0.004, if(!IsPlayerInRangeOfPoint(playerid, ЗАКРЫТ, 1; 0.02, { шлагбаума. } "статус" открываем if(status_slak ставим закрываем шлагбаума else 1)//Если }
0.00000,10.00000,135.1000);//Здесь if(status_slak true) координаты 1;//7.0 obj_slak; -1654.6792,535.8877,37.4041)) MoveObject(obj_slak, 0)//Если его "статус" ЗАКРЫТ, "/slak", -
 
не не равно пересекаются. свои. реагирует... , у шлагбаумов всё но координаты второй радиусы
 
открываем = if(status_slak ставим где } -1658.2186,543.5646,37.9824-0.004, должен его } else А 0.02, сработала его /slak2 if(!IsPlayerInRangeOfPoint(playerid, шлагбаум 1;//Ставим радиус status_slak if(strcmp(cmd, должен Одну return true) закрытого чтобы ставим if(status_slak всё открытого закрываем шлагбаума. == 0.000000,0.000000,136.9800);//Здесь открытого 0.02, 0.02, шлагбаум if(status_slak if(!IsPlayerConnected(playerid)) получается 0.02, { "/slak", = его 1; нужно 1; return координаты == ЗАКРЫТ if(!IsPlayerInRangeOfPoint(playerid, ставим -1668.7000,553.5862,37.8530+0.004, "статус" MoveObject(obj_slak, ОТКРЫТ, шлагбаум сработала if(strcmp(cmd, "статус" шлагбаума 0)//Если радиус 1; координаты return игрок == } - 15.0, return где //------------------------------------------------------------------------------ открываем закрываем ОТКРЫТ status_slak1 его ЗАКРЫТ, 0;//Ставим MoveObject(obj_slak, MoveObject(obj_slak, т.е. умному это status_slak 1; 15.0, сделай else из if(status_slak } ЗАКРЫТ "/slak2", == -1654.6792,535.8877,37.4041)) 1;//Ставим ЗАКРЫТ, -1658.1230,543.4621,37.9025+0.004, шлагбаума. 1;//7.0 по шлагбаума } 0)//Если другому.... - 1)//Если по MoveObject(obj_slak, "статус" находится ставим { игрок шлагбаум это 0.00000,90.00000,135.1000);//Здесь команд так: == 1)//Если -1668.6481,553.5288,37.9824-0.004, 1;//7.0 шлагбаума. делать true) 0;//Ставим команда "статус" закрытого } шлагбаума { 0) координаты координаты чтобы { return команда == находится ОТКРЫТ вообще шлагбаума 0.00000,10.00000,135.1000);//Здесь { шлагбаума. { = if(!IsPlayerConnected(playerid)) return = status_slak 0.000000,-90.000000,136.9800);//Здесь -1676.43958,556.5943,37.3641)) 0) ОТКРЫТ,
 
, если [/COLOR]команды не написать кто а сделайте DC_CMD/ZCMD и под как это может тяжело тут выложите! Извините на или урок сделать
 
А должен открываться? 15 он секунд
 
и предполагает, откроются, команду, раз данная трижды - - так далее... откроются команда один закроются, oleganikin1, что дважды конкретно ворота ввести если
 

Кто прочитал эту тему (Всего: 0) за последние 1 часов Посмотреть детально

    Кто просматривал эту тему (Всего: 0, Пользователей: 0, Гостей: 0)

      Кто отслеживал эту тему (Всего: 0) Посмотреть детально

        Похожие темы

        Назад
        Сверху